Understanding Your Face Shape
Before you dive into the world of short hairstyles, it's crucial to understand your face shape. This will help you choose a cut that accentuates your features rather than detracting from them. The most common face shapes are oval, round, square, heart, and long. Use a mirror and a flexible measuring tape to determine your face shape.
Popular Short Hairstyles for Different Face Shapes
Oval Face Shape
Lucky you! Oval face shapes can pull off almost any hairstyle. For a short cut, consider a pixie cut with choppy layers or a sleek bob. These styles can help balance your features and add texture to your hair.

Round Face Shape
Short hairstyles that add height at the crown and have shorter layers around the face can create the illusion of a longer face. A pixie cut with long bangs or a graduated bob can help achieve this. Avoid blunt cuts and one-length styles as they can make your face appear rounder.
Square Face Shape
To soften the angular lines of a square face, opt for short hairstyles with soft, rounded edges. A bob with a side part or a pixie cut with wispy bangs can help achieve this. Layered cuts can also help to break up the harsh lines of a square face.
Heart Face Shape
Heart-shaped faces have a wider forehead and a narrow chin. To balance these features, choose short hairstyles that add volume at the chin and have shorter layers around the face. A pixie cut with long bangs or a bob with a deep side part can help achieve this.

Long Face Shape
To create the illusion of width, choose short hairstyles that add volume at the sides. A pixie cut with choppy layers or a bob with a side part can help achieve this. Avoid styles that are too long or one-length as they can make your face appear longer.

Maintaining Your Short Hairstyle
Maintaining a short hairstyle requires regular upkeep to keep it looking its best. Here are some tips:

| Hairstyle | Recommended Trim Frequency |
|---|---|
| Pixie Cut | Every 4-6 weeks |
| Bob | Every 6-8 weeks |
| Undercut | Every 4-6 weeks |
Regular trims will help maintain the shape of your hairstyle and prevent split ends. Additionally, using the right products can help keep your hair looking its best. For fine hair, use a lightweight mousse or styling cream to add volume. For thick hair, use a smoothing serum to tame frizz and flyaways.
